Sports broadcasting commenced in 1911 in Lawrence, Kansas. A single evening, all around 1,000 people gathered alongside one another in an effort to check out a copy from the Kansas vs. Missouri soccer activity, all while the sport was getting performed live in Missouri. To do that, Western Union set up a telegraph wire in Columbia, Missouri, the location of the game in which the sport was essentially remaining played.
